About

Zoltán Varga is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Surgery and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Zoltán Varga has authored 127 papers receiving a total of 2.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 57 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, 25 papers in Surgery and 25 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Zoltán Varga's work include Renal cell carcinoma treatment (21 papers), Advanced Radiotherapy Techniques (16 papers) and Breast Cancer Treatment Studies (12 papers). Zoltán Varga is often cited by papers focused on Renal cell carcinoma treatment (21 papers), Advanced Radiotherapy Techniques (16 papers) and Breast Cancer Treatment Studies (12 papers). Zoltán Varga collaborates with scholars based in Hungary, Germany and United States. Zoltán Varga's co-authors include Axel Heidenreich, Rolf von Knobloch, Rainer Hofmann, Axel Hegele, Zsuzsanna Kahán, P. Olbert, Syed Rafay Ali Sabzwari, Andres Jan Schrader, László Thurzó and Katalin Hidéghety and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Circulation and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
